Job Description: |
Responsibilities
- Active case finding within the target community
- Use universal precautions while dealing with clients and/or PLHIV (supportive/nursing care/treatment) and conducting community based testing.
- Ensure & provide need based care and support services.
- Facilitate referrals to CBO sites, ART centres, external services and entities.
- Visiting hotspots to for Voluntary Counselling and Testing purposes
- Overall physical assessment of clients, target population, community and PLHIV, taking the vitals (Blood pressure, weight, height). In case of any change in client or patient's condition/complaints, inform the project manager for follow-up with the ART/Treating Physician or medical referral.
- Ensure proper storage & report on the status of STI medicines, testing kits and other consumables.
- Coordinate with Drop-in-centre Coordinator Outreach in following workplans for outreach and follow-up activities.
- Ensure timely management, completion, accuracy and documentation of VCT/HTC register and ensure that the date is entered in the required formats (for monitoring and review purposes).
- Attend staff meetings when required
Required Knowledge
- HIV/AIDS education and awareness
- Knowledge of universal precautions while dealing with the clients and/or PLHIV (care, support or testing).
- Knowledge of types of counselling while dealing with positive clients
- Should have command on types of counselling to be provided during field visits to hotspots, DIC, Community centres and gatherings.
- Strong knowledge of types of counselling while dealing with positive and other clients:
- HIV prevention/transmission/risk reduction counselling
- Pre and Post-test counselling
- Treatment adherence
- Infant feeding and child care
- Nutritional counselling
- Psychological support counselling

Company Name: MDG Achieving Organization Company Description: Active since 2018, MDG Achieving Organization is a community based organization operating in Sindh under The Global Fund Grant and UNDP on disease control. The project is aimed to mainly increase access to effective prevention, diagnosis, treatment and care of HIV and AIDS among key population.
